Ref.4190 : ELEGANT RESTORED MANOR HOUSE ON THE BANKS OF THE LOIRE RIVER, 13 KM FROM DOWNTOWN NANTES The property is close to a pleasant little town on the banks of the Loire, to the east of Nantes. It's a gateway between the north and south of this timelessly charming, world-renowned river. The area offers a pleasant living environment, much sought-after by hikers and bikers alike, with numerous green spaces, parks and gardens. This small town of 10,000 inhabitants, which has retained its village spirit, offers a wide range of services, including a sports park, cultural center, leisure centers, five schools and a secondary school. The town has also made a point of preserving its historical heritage, which includes a castle with a remarkable dovecote, listed as a historic monument, a Roman bridge and numerous late 19th century homes. The town is within easy reach of the freeway, less than 10 minutes by train to Nantes and 20 minutes to Nantes Atlantique airport. At the end of a cul-de-sac, the partly walled residence is revealed through a beautiful gate. The gate is made of solid wrought iron and decorated with bunches of grapes. It was made by an expert wrought-iron craftsman and is supported by two handsome stone pillars. In keeping with its image, the entire property has been remarkably renovated and maintained, with meticulous attention to every detail. The maison de maître nestles in 8,000m² of parkland with age-old trees, giving it a serene atmosphere. As soon as you cross the threshold, you're welcomed into an atmosphere full of charm and elegance. The owners have chosen top-quality materials in a harmony of natural tones. The interior spaces are generous and bathed in light. With approximately 390sqm of living space, the house is laid out as follows: The ground floor offers a perfectly fluid layout, with adjoining reception rooms and lovely views over the park. The Burgundy stone floor contributes to the authentic feel of the place, with its rough edges and natural hues. A through entrance leads to a vast living room with marble fireplace. It opens onto a spacious dining room with fireplace, creating the ideal space for entertaining. The fully-equipped, resolutely modern kitchen overlooks the park. A room adjoining the kitchen, with bleached beams and a lovely rustic feel, is also ideal for meals. This room has ample storage space. A study overlooking the park, with an unfinished wooden bookcase occupying an entire wall. Laundry room, wc. The original staircase leads to the upper floors. The 1st floor features 2 large suites, each an invitation to relaxation and comfort. The windows offer soothing views over the park, creating a feeling of communion with the surrounding nature. The first suite, in shades of gray and with a beautiful parquet floor, has a dressing room fitted out in wood. It includes a bathroom with bathtub and walk-in shower and pebbled floor. The second suite, in moss-green tones, also features a dressing room, and a beige-toned bathroom with walk-in shower and pebbled floor. The 2nd floor features a bright bedroom with ample storage space, and a further room that could be used as a playroom or office. Another very large room with plenty of storage space and a bathroom. Accessible from both inside and outside the house, a staircase leads to the first floor. Here you'll find a bedroom with stone walls, exposed beams and parquet flooring. It has its own shower room. Two other rooms, also with stone walls and exposed beams, can be used as offices and offer ideal space for telecommuting. Their independent access means they can also be used for a professional activity. The outbuildings include: - A renovated garage, paved floor, exposed stone walls: 2 cars. - Three small stone sheds. - Small outbuilding with bread oven. - Henhouse The 8,000sqm park surrounding the house is an oasis of tranquility, unoverlooked and partly enclosed by old stone walls. The centuries-old trees, silent witnesses to the passing of time, provide soothing shade and create an idyllic setting. These include a hundred-year-old cedar, oaks, a prunus, a tulip tree and a bamboo grove. At the far end of the park is a rectangular stone pool accessed by stone steps, adding a touch of romance to the park. The pond is fed by a spring. A large orchard planted with fruit trees is ideal for making jams and pies. A beautifully restored henhouse will welcome your chickens. Ref.4141 : ELEGANT 16th CENTURY HOUSE BETWEEN ANGERS AND NANTES This elegant 16th-century town house is set in a charming little town typical of the Mauges region, not far from Cholet. Overlooking a valley with a delightful meandering stream below, the house boasts uninterrupted views over the surrounding countryside. Situated between Angers and Nantes, it is within easy reach of the major cities of the west and the region's most attractive tourist attractions: Puy du Fou, Cholet golf course, châteaux, museums, festivals, etc. The Atlantic coast is a 1h30 drive away. A rich heritage of traditional old Loire villages is also available to lovers of old stone. The quality of life in the town where we are based is particularly pleasant. Schools (primary, lower and upper secondary) and a wide range of shops (markets, supermarkets, bakeries, restaurants, post office, prêt-à-porter, etc.) are all within walking distance. The area also offers a wide range of cultural and sporting activities: castle and monuments, library, theatres (with high-quality annual programmes), music school, cinema, horse-racing, horse-riding, swimming pool, golf course, walks in several hectares of parkland and numerous walks in the surrounding area. This place offers a wonderful compromise between dynamism and peace of mind. Built over three floors of ashlar and rendered stone rubble under tiles, this residence spans approx. 400 sqm (4,305 sq ft) of living space and comprises a main building and a wing set at right angles to it. It has the unusual feature of being flanked by two turrets, one cylindrical under slates and the other quadrangular corbelled. Another, more imposing tower is located at the rear of the building. It is harmoniously fitted with numerous openings with tufa stone surrounds, providing beneficial light in all areas. For the past 8 years, the house has been home to a bed and breakfast business and a private practice, all in perfect harmony with family life. The house is therefore ideally suited to a wide variety of projects, both personal and professional. The rooms are arranged as follows: On the ground floor, an entrance hall leads to the right to a large kitchen with direct access to the outside. Opposite, two rooms have been converted for use as professional offices with independent access. To the left are a dining room, a study and a large lounge. There are terracotta, tiled and parquet floors, a 15th century granite fireplace, a marble mantelpiece and exposed beams. Two spiral staircases, in one of the turrets and in the tower, lead upstairs. On the first floor, a hallway leads on either side to four bedrooms, two shower rooms and a library. The floors are of old terracotta tiles or covered with a flexible covering and there are exposed beams. On the second floor, a landing gives access to two bedrooms and an attic that could be converted into two further bedrooms and a bathroom. The floors are in beautiful old terracotta tiles, some walls are rendered in stone and the roof timbers are exposed. In the basement, there are attractive, spacious cellars. There is a lean-to in the rear courtyard that could be used as a woodshed or sheltered shed. A 60sqm courtyard, completely enclosed by walls and beautifully planted, is a sort of natural open-air alcove, revealing the spirit of confidentiality that reigns here. A 30sqm rear courtyard, also enclosed by walls, extends this intimate atmosphere. The total land area is 329sqm. Cabinet LE NAIL – Maine-et-Loire - M. This elegant and historic Château Choletais offers the charm and calm of the countryside at the gates of the city with a breathtaking view of the lake. Built in 1862 by the famous architect René Hodé, this unique property currently operated as a Hotel-Restaurant reveals approximately 1500 m² of living space in the heart of a vast wooded and landscaped park of 3.4 hectares. A majestic and long driveway in the woods leads to this architectural ensemble built from Mortagne granite and Saumur tufa. The facade recalls Italian architecture with its large flat pilasters and dormers crowned with ribbed shells. This place steeped in history takes us back in time from the entrance. Built on 4 levels, the authentic setting, period decoration and stylish furniture transport us to the world of Château life. The 1st floor accommodates various reception rooms as well as the dining room. In the continuation, a beautiful chapel. The monumental staircase leads to the floors dedicated to the sleeping areas of the hotel where each friendly and refined room reveals its unique character, each of them having a bathroom. A completely renovated private apartment completes this second floor. The third level gives way to a row of several bedrooms. The last level of this house offers several rooms to be reinvented according to use. The exteriors guarantee peace, serenity and relaxation at the edge of a heated swimming pool, terrace as well as a squash room. This exceptional property is close to all amenities and shops. Ref 4250: Charming fortified house in south anjou for sale This charming 16th-century fortified house, renovated in the 19th century, is set in a charming little village in the Mauges not far from Cholet. Boasting uninterrupted views over the surrounding countryside, it dominates the undulating valleys below. Situated on an axis between Angers and Nantes, the property is within easy reach of the main economic, commercial and tourist centres in the west of France. The Atlantic coast is around 1? hours away. A number of essential shops can be found in the neighbouring market town (bakery, hairdresser, etc.), and the town of Cholet offers all the necessities and amenities that can be found nearby. Built of local stone under slate roofs, this remarkable building features a regular seven-bay, two-storey main building to the south, extended by a two-bay, three-storey pavilion, and bordered by a large terrace facing a square courtyard, itself framed by former vernacular pleasure buildings. To the north, it has a second quadragular pavilion flanked by a corbelled turret and housing a freestanding staircase. A large canopy and a monumental glass roof linking the two buildings back onto it. With a floor surface area of approx. 500 sqm, it is laid out as follows: Ground floor: from the glass roof: Entrance hall leading to a vast living room (65.90 sqm), all on one level with a terrace, travertine floor, beautiful fireplace with wood-burning insert, 'Art Nouveau' cast iron radiators, wooden shutters, exposed joists and high ceilings (3.5m). To the east, an adjoining dining room opens onto a semi-professional kitchen (82sqm), also on the same level as the terrace, with tiled floors, an insert fireplace, wooden shutters, exposed joists and ceiling heights identical to those in the living room (3.5m). A contemporary conservatory adjoins the kitchen, giving the living rooms a comfortable, well-exposed extension with views over the orchard. Back kitchen and utility rooms behind the kitchen. To the west, a large, double-exposed lounge with parquet flooring, fireplace and staircase giving access to the upper floors of the bungalow, with high ceilings (3.5 m). The 1st floor comprises a landing and corridors leading to six bedrooms, a dressing room and two large bathrooms. Beautiful parquet flooring and interior wooden shutters. On the 2nd floor: a bedroom/dormitory in the west pavilion and a bedroom in the north pavilion accessed by a beautiful spiral staircase, both with beautiful parquet flooring and remarkable exposed roofing frameworks. Monumental granite fireplace in the bedroom in the north pavilion. The property has several outbuildings: -Perpendicular to and adjoining the dwelling, an outbuilding or gîte for renovation. -Opposite, an old stable in need of renovation. -Below the courtyard, a large barn in need of renovation. -Bread oven to renovate. - A stone shelter on the edge of a pond - An awning adjoining the dwelling Large, pleasant grounds of approx. 2.5 acres with courtyards, driveways and gardens, vegetable garden, meadows and orchards, pond and a number of beautiful trees (apple trees, pine trees, olive trees, broad-leaved trees, etc.). The views from here are splendid. Cabinet LE NAIL – Maine-et-Loire - M.
